Genesis 7:6

And Noah was six hundred years old when the flood of waters
was upon the earth
When it began, for he was in his six hundred and first year when it ended, ( Genesis 8:13 ) his eldest son was now an hundred years old, since when Noah was five hundred years old he begat children, ( Genesis 5:32 ) .
